France "enduringly popular among Brits" by Cheap Flights Booker UK
France remains a highly popular destination among British holidaymakers and is continuing to attract visitors despite the financial crisis and the unfavourable pound-to-euro exchange rate, according to a travel expert.
Sean Tipton, a spokesman for Abta - The Travel Association, said that Paris is "by far the most popular French city" for Britons.
He also recommended the Brittany region for families, pointing out that it is affordable and easy to reach.
Listing some of the factors that make France so popular, Mr Tipton said: "It"s the food, beautiful countryside, it"s often very good value as well compared with the UK and the climate is better than most of the UK."
The Abta spokesman also highlighted the importance of the country"s accessibility for British travellers, saying that its close proximity "definitely affects choice".
It was recently reported that France, the world"s most visited country, received 74.2m tourists last year, down from 79.2m in 2008.
